Planning for Peak Waste Generation

Motorsports events, especially those in Nairobi, attract large crowds, leading to significant waste generation. Our approach to motorsports event waste management begins with meticulous planning. We conduct a thorough assessment of expected attendance, event duration, and venue layout to determine the optimal number and types of waste receptacles needed. This includes general waste bins, recycling stations, and specialized disposal units for specific materials. Strategic placement of these bins in high-traffic areas, food courts, and spectator zones is key to encouraging proper disposal and minimizing litter. Our planning ensures efficient resource allocation for a clean event.

Specialized Waste Handling

Motorsports events can generate unique waste streams beyond typical refuse. Our motorsports event waste management services include provisions for handling specific materials such as used tires, engine oils, and other automotive fluids. We ensure these are collected, stored, and disposed of in an environmentally sound and legally compliant manner. This specialized handling is critical for preventing pollution and meeting regulatory requirements.
